GOOD START
![]() Saturday saw positive results for teams from Terengganu in the Malaysian Super League. Despite not able to take full points from their match against Kedah, Terengganu managed to stop the habit of losing to the Canaries this season after a 1-1 draw in Kuala Terengganu. But the broader smile would be on Che Ku Marzuki's face after his boys completed the 'double' over 2010 Malaysian FA Cup winners, Negeri Sembilan in Paroi.
At the Sultan Ismail Nasiruddin Shah Stadium, Terengganu began on a bright and aggresive note against their tormentor in Alor Setar last week. For the home fans they did not have to wait long to celebrate when striker Abdul Manaf Mamat shrugged off the challenge from Kedah defender Fazliata Taib for the ball before calmly beating Abdul Hadi Abdul Hamid in the Kedah goal.
Many would have expected the floodgates to open but the visitors began to get their rhytym to the match. despite this Terengganu created a number of chances to increase their lead with Manaf hitting the bar with a header and topscorer Ashaari Shamsuddin was able to get his shots away but did not really trouble Abdul Hadi.
But the real turning point of the match was when Manaf was brought down from behind by Fazliata in the box but referee Abu Bakar Mohd Noor waved the tackle from behind was legal despite the striker had to be taken off for treatment.
At half-time the score was 1-0 to the home side but it did not last long. Whatever was said during the break by Kedah Head Coach Ahmad Yusoff certainly had it effects as Kedah started the second with a second wind. Terengganu defence led by skipper Marzuki Yusof had to work hard trying to keep their goal intact. Then they conceded a free-kick just outside the box, something that would come back to haunt them. From the freekick goalkeeper Sharbinee Allawee failed to gather the ball cleanly and substitute Khyril Muhymeen who came on for Azlan Ismail at the start of the second half, pounced on the rebound to level the score for Kedah.
Both teams then went all out looking for the winner but in the end just could not find the way through.
Meanwhile in Paroi T-Team had to endure the barrage of attacks by the home side, determined to avenge their defeat in Kuala Terengganu last week. However they failed to find their way through due to their misfiring front line. The home side had a bigger hill to climb when their skipper Reezal Zambry Yahya was sent off due to a second bookable offence.
With ten men, Negeri Sembilan seemed to content to play for just a point but deep into injury time T-Team topscorer Abdul Hadi Yahaya found himself a yard of space just outside the penalty box and unleashed a stinging shot that had goalkeeper Sani Anuar beaten all the way.
The three points saw T-Team climbed to fifth in the league and if they can keep up their winning ways Terengganu football fans will have two teams to cheer at the top of the Malaysian Super League in the second half of the season.
